Output 2918200375bd085be0fa686bade5061ebbf42b17977656ff7be0c2e98cc4b720:2

value
2103942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9adaa4d85305351687aa05662743b9964fc408e9 OP_EQUAL
address
3FooujQUi83YsXyb8sysmtS6NX7rfK5fiH
transaction
2918200375bd085be0fa686bade5061ebbf42b17977656ff7be0c2e98cc4b720
confirmations
29
spent
true